问题标题: 酷町堂:1698 找座位

0
0
已解决
岳成浩
岳成浩
资深守护
资深守护
#include<iostream>
#include<cstdio>
#include<cmath>
using namespace std;
int main()
{
    for(int i=1;i<=200;i++){
        if(i%7==0&&i%10!=4&&i%10!=8){
            cout<<i<<" ";
        }
    }
    return 0;
}

哪里错了?谢谢各位


0
已采纳
李显晨
李显晨
中级启示者
中级启示者

每次输出i应该用换行隔开

0
0
李宜和
李宜和
高级启示者
高级启示者
#include<iostream> 
#include<cmath> 
#include<cstdio> 
using namespace std; 
long long n,cnt[100000],a; 
int main(){ 
    cin>>n;
    while(1){
        cin>>a;
        if(a==0){
            break;
        }
        cnt[a]++;
    }
    for(int i=1;i<=n;i++){
        cout<<i<<" "<<cnt[i]<<endl;
    }

    return 0; 
}

 

0
0
徐子宸
徐子宸
中级天翼
中级天翼

将i%10!=4&&i%10!=8打括号

徐子宸在2020-07-27 17:43:21追加了内容

吧空格该换行

0
陆苏新
陆苏新
修练者
修练者

 

 

每个编号应用换行隔开

#include<iostream>
#include<cstdio>
#include<cmath>

using namespace std;

int main()
{
    for(int i=1;i<=200;i++)
    {
        if(i%7==0&&i%10!=4&&i%10!=8)
        {
            cout<<i<<endl;
        }
    }
   
    return 0;
}

0
潘晨皓
潘晨皓
高级天翼
高级天翼

if(i%7==0&&__i%10!=4&&i%10!=8)

是不是少了“(”?

 

潘晨皓在2020-07-27 18:50:47追加了内容

还有,换行!!!

endl

我要回答